Two more senior officials are leaving Number 10 in an apparent mass exodus from Downing Street amid the fallout from the partygate scandal. Number 10 revealed on Thursday night that both Dan Rosenfield, the prime minister’s chief of staff, and Martin Reynolds, Mr Johnson’s principal private secretary, are leaving their roles. Two of Jeffrey Epstein’s underage victims in Florida filed a shocking defamation lawsuit Thursday against Miami Herald reporter Julie K. Brown. Brown’s award-winning investigation into the disgraced financier’s prior sweetheart deal with prosecutors helped trigger Epstein’s 2019 sex trafficking indictment. The Bank of England has raised interest rates, slashed its growth forecast and warned that families are about to suffer the biggest fall in living standards since comparable records began three decades ago. The Los Angeles City Clerk approved a petition for circulation today that aims to have the City Council repeal its requirement that people show proof of vaccination against Covid-19 before entering certain indoor public spaces and outdoor “mega-events.” The effort is backed, in part, by the Libertarian Party of Los Angeles County. Cisco has patched multiple critical security vulnerabilities impacting its RV Series routers that could be weaponized to elevate privileges and execute arbitrary code on affected systems, while also warning of the existence of proof-of-concept (PoC) exploit code targeting some of these bugs.
